Manufacturing of Porous Alumina Ceramic by Gel Casting
原文传递
导出
摘要 Various quantities of non-toxic monomer (2-hydroxyethyl methacrylate, HEMA) was added to form porous alumina ceramic by gel casting process. Pure water, monomer, cross-linker (N, N'-methylene-bis-acrylamide (MBAm)), and dispersant (ammonium salt of poly (methacrylic acid), PAS) were combined to form an aqueous solution, which added alumina powder and was milled to form alumina slurry with zirconia balls for 240 minutes. An initiator (ammonium persulfate, APS) was added to the alumina slurry with a vacuum mixing system and formed in an inverted metal mold. After heat treatment, curing, stripping and drying, the alumina green body was sintered at 1200, 1300, 1400, 1500 and 1600 ℃ for 1 h. The original alumina powder and sintered porous alumina ceramic materials were analyzed for particle size, viscosity, TGA/DTA, sintering density, porosity, SEM, XRD and bending strength. The results show that the porous alumina ceramic can be prepared with porosity of 12-48 wt% and bending strength of 17-153 MPa at various monomer content of 5-25 wt% and sintering temperatures of 1200-1500 ℃.
